migucanada profile picture

migucanada

ca flag

Last match: 3 hours ago

1 games - 1W 0L

100.00%
Mode Rank Elo Win %
Sup 1v1 #12108 911 48.46% 63W 67L
#6691
1036

Games 130

Hours played 48

Units killed 14,505

Units lost 4,695

Buildings razed 1,084

Heat l32l profile picture

Heat l32l

Elo past 90 days

Major God Stats

god win %
Hades portrait Hades 100.00%

Major God Matchups

Recent Matches

Watering Hole minimap

Watering Hole

Sup 1v1

37:22

4 days ago

11/9/2024, 11:04 PM UTC

Patch 17.43876

918

15

vs.

872

15